网站检测代理ip
在互联网时代,数据是最为重要的资产之一。作为一名SEO人员,我们需要不断地收集、分析和利用数据来提高网站排名和流量。而采集百度关键词链接是一个非常重要的环节,本文将从8个方面详细介绍如何批量采集百度关键词链接。
我们可以通过Selenium模拟浏览器行为,获取到搜索结果页面的HTML源码。然后,通过BeautifulSoup库解析HTML源码,获取到每个搜索结果对应的URL。
由于百度对于爬虫行为有限制,我们需要使用代理IP来隐藏自己的真实IP地址。可以选择购买或者免费获取代理IP池,然后通过设置Selenium的代理选项来实现。
过快的爬取速度会引起百度的反爬虫机制,影响采集效果。我们可以通过设置Selenium的页面加载时间、间隔时间等参数来控制采集速度。
在采集过程中网站检测代理ip,可能会出现重复的URL。我们需要对采集到的URL进行去重处理,避免重复采集和分析。
通过以上步骤,我们已经可以获取到单个关键词的搜索结果页链接。而批量采集关键词链接可以通过循环遍历多个关键词实现。可以通过读取文本文件或者数据库中的关键词列表进行循环遍历。
在采集到大量关键词链接后,我们需要对这些数据进行分析和存储。可以使用Python相关库进行数据分析和处理,并将结果存储到Excel、CSV等格式文件或者数据库中。
通过以上8个方面的介绍,相信大家已经了解如何批量采集百度关键词链接了。希望本文对您有所帮助。返回搜狐,查看更多